Three consecutive natural numbers are such that three times the middle number is greater than the
sum of the other two by 11, then find out the numbers?​

Let the number in the middle = x

Then, the smaller number = x - 1

The larger number = x + 1

Given,

      3 * ( x ) = x - 1 + x + 1 + 11

            3x = 2x + 11

             x = 11

∴ The required consecutive numbers are 10, 11, 12.
